Stayed Jun 17, 2023Very comfortable 8 night stay with our two pocket beagles in this rustic cabin with many thoughtful touches and amenities. High quality, solid wood furniture and plenty of dishes for cooking, as well as a gas grill out back. A full container of coffee, 4 rolls of toilet paper, and six sets of towels were also provided (the guest info book said there were additional towels stored somewhere, but we didn't need them for just two people). The internet was fast and reliable. Don't forget to bring your own beach towels, chairs, and umbrella, as these are not provided. Yes, there is a musty smell in the cabin -- but all cottages of a certain age that get closed up in the winter have this exact same smell. It didn't bother me a bit, and you only smell it when you first enter the cabin. The hard water may also bother some, but again, all the cabins in this area have hard water. The only negative was that the bathroom felt too cramped and small for me and my husband, but that's par for the course for a summer cabin! A keyless entry door handle would also be a nice improvement. Overall, a fantastic rental -- I grew up on Portage Point, and this is the best location possible and the best value if you are traveling with dogs. I'm so grateful that the owner allows dogs, because there are few places in this area that are reasonably priced AND accept dogs.
